Daily Braces Care Routine

1. Brush After Every Meal

Food can easily get trapped in brackets and wires, increasing the risk of plaque buildup. Brush your teeth thoroughly after every meal using a soft-bristled toothbrush.

Focus on:

  • Around brackets and wires
  • Along the gumline
  • All tooth surfaces

2. Floss Daily

Flossing with braces can be tricky, but it’s essential. Use floss threaders or orthodontic floss to clean between your teeth and under the wires.

3. Use Mouthwash

An antibacterial mouthwash helps reduce plaque and keeps your mouth fresh. It also reaches areas that brushing and flossing may miss.

Foods to Avoid with Braces

Your diet plays a big role in protecting your braces. Avoid:

  • Hard foods (nuts, ice, hard sweets)
  • Sticky foods (toffee, chewing gum)
  • Crunchy foods (popcorn, chips)
  • Sugary snacks and drinks

These can damage brackets or wires and increase the risk of cavities.

Managing Discomfort

It’s normal to experience some discomfort, especially after adjustments. To manage this:

  • Use orthodontic wax to cover irritating brackets
  • Rinse with warm salt water
  • Stick to soft foods when your mouth feels sensitive

If pain persists, consult your dentist.

Protecting Your Braces

If you play sports or engage in physical activities, wearing a mouthguard is essential to protect both your braces and your teeth from injury.

Keep Your Appointments

Regular check-ups are crucial for tracking progress and making necessary adjustments. Missing appointments can delay your treatment and affect your results.

Signs You Should See Your Dentist

Contact your dental provider if you experience:

  • Loose or broken brackets
  • Protruding wires causing discomfort
  • Swelling or bleeding gums
  • Persistent pain

Early intervention can prevent bigger issues.
